How To Choose a Roofing Company

A new roof installation is a large home renovation that can cost tens of thousands of dollars. It's crucial to research and find the most qualified and reputable roofing company for the job. Here are the top things to evaluate when selecting a roofer.

  • Experience and credentials: Companies that have been in business for over 10 years show stability and expertise. Before hiring, make sure the company has current licenses, bonding, and insurance. Ask about professional certifications, such as those from the National Roofing Contractors Association.
  • Detailed written estimate: Trustworthy roofing providers will give you a comprehensive written proposal. This estimate should outline the complete work plan, materials needed, and total price without hidden fees. Steer clear of unclear bids, or ones that seem much too low or high.
  • Warranties and guarantees: The best roofers provide robust manufacturer warranties on shingles lasting over 30 years, together with at least a 5-year labor warranty. Avoid companies with less robust coverage.
  • Responsiveness and communication: From estimate to project completion, your contractor should maintain ongoing communication with you, answer all questions, and handle any concerns.
  • Roofing materials and products: Quality roofing materials from leading manufacturers are able to handle Kendall West's weather and hold up for decades. Beware of contractors who push extremely low-cost materials or generic products. Check out shingle samples before deciding.
  • References and reviews: Vet companies thoroughly by verifying on review sites such as Google, Yelp, or the Better Business Bureau (BBB) that they have consistently positive feedback. You can also request recent local references to learn more.

Signs Your Roof Needs Repair or Replacement

You may not think about your roof daily, but it plays a vital role protecting your home. Be aware of these common signals that your roof needs to be evaluated and repaired by a professional roofer.

Roof Age

Your roof's age and material are both important. The most common residential roofing material is asphalt shingles, which typically last about 20 to 25 years before needing to be replaced. Schedule an inspection if your roof is approaching this age to determine if a full replacement is needed.

Leaks or Water Stains in Your Home

One of the most obvious signs of roof trouble is water leaks. Stains on your walls, insulation, or ceilings, or in your attic likely indicate water seeping through worn or damaged shingles. Even small leaks should not be ignored, as they can lead to mold growth and further damage your roof.

Exposed Roof Decking Underneath Shingles

If you can see roof deck boards or sheathing under shingles, it shows that those shingles are severely curling or losing their seal. This means it's time for replacement. Shingles should lie flat to prevent water from entering your home.

Cracked, Broken, or Missing Shingles

Check your shingles thoroughly from ground level or a safe ladder. Look for ones that are damaged or that no longer have their protective coating. Over time, hurricanes and other storms can cause surface damage. To keep your roof in good shape, replace any missing shingles or ones that have gaping holes.

Flashing Deterioration Around Roof Penetrations

Roof flashing seals off vents, valleys, chimneys, and other areas that pass through the roof. If the metal flashing is cracked, peeling away, or completely worn out, it can leak. Have any issues with roof flashing fixed right away.

Sagging Roof Line

If your roof sags or is uneven, schedule a professional inspection. These issues could signal a structural problem. A sagging roof that's not given adequate structural reinforcement or full replacement will worsen over time.

Contractors in Florida can be registered or certified. Registered contractors work in a specific city or county, must meet certain competencies and are required to have business insurance. Certified contractors can work anywhere in the state, and must hold roofing insurance, among other additional requirements. Both types of license are handled through the Department of Business and Professional Regulation.

A professional might either pressure wash or "soft wash" your roof, depending on the roofing material and how much cleaning is needed. Power washing is not recommended for certain roof types like asphalt shingles. To soft wash your roof, your contractor might use chemicals like bleach and detergent, and tools such as brushes and brooms.

After your roof has been installed, check the roof's appearance. If it looks uneven or not uniform, this is a sign that the roof was not installed correctly. Also, check that the flashing wasn't reused. Flashing is important to prevent leaks and water damage to your home. Finally, you'll want to check that your contractor placed an underlayment between the shingles and sheathing of your house. This helps prevent leaks and extends your roof's lifespan.
